Title: Densification of expanded graphite
Authors: Celzard, A., Schneider, S., Mare^che´, J.F.
Superior Title: Carbon; 2002, Vol. 40 Issue: 12 p2185-2191, 7p
Abstract: A brief theoretical investigation of the behavior of exfoliated graphite (EG) undergoing compaction is presented. Simple arguments and assumptions allow one to calculate the density of the initial individual worm-like particles of EG for any final porosity of the resultant consolidated blocks. These results as well as excluded volume considerations are used to derive the mean disorientation angle of the graphite sheets within the blocks of compressed EG. X-ray experiments were performed on such autoconsolidated samples. The overall mosaic spreads thus obtained are shown to be in a very good agreement with the model developed in this paper.
